In the Canadian Armed Forces, serve as a Personnel Selection Officer and shape military leadership through expertise in behavioral science and human resource assessment. Agile and significant role awaits.
As a Personnel Selection Officer, you will direct your expertise in behavioral science to evaluate and recommend military candidates for training and professional development. This role empowers you to engage with recruits and conduct advanced research, fostering a well-prepared military force. Your responsibilities extend to training others in effective assessment techniques and enhancing organizational strategies.
Key Responsibilities:
• Recommend special training for CAF personnel
• Conduct applied behavioral research and occupational assessments
• Teach leadership courses for military education
• Train career counsellors in effective interview methods
• Design and develop personnel selection processes
Requirements:
• Master's degree in psychology or a related field
• Proven experience with behavioral assessments
• Knowledge of military selection practices
• Completion of specialized military training
• Strong analytical capabilities in human resources
